Transaction 49a080e03736c0c770af6fa0b602d385537b68fd92338b0f384599ddcedeca49

3 Input
1 Outputs
  • 49a080e03736c0c770af6fa0b602d385537b68fd92338b0f384599ddcedeca49:0
  • value  22056114
    address  37xirBdMjrNoi2EbJMrSZo9mD9bza2N1J6